Will a 110" Vutec Silverstar paired with my RS1 be to big with a seating distance of 11' ?


Room 13' x 22'

Ceiling white 8' walls are light tan

Throw 11.5'

Seating Distance 11'

Mounted on a shelf 20 inches from the ceiling


My installer friend says the Vutec Silverstar is the best way to go with a RS1s low brightness ?

He can get me a 110" Vutec Silverstar for like 1K

I live in Florida and Vutec located near me.


Does anyone have any other suggestions for a screen ?

Better bang for the buck maybe ?


I have it setup as a main TV for everyday viewing in my living room.

I can control the Ambient light but I like to have some dim lights on in or around the room 90 percent of the time unless I'm watching a movie then i shut down all the lights

I don't think it will be too big, but you might be bothered by the appearance of the screen surface. It tends to show up easily on the Silverstar, due to the nature of the surface and the fact that it is high gain. Get a demo at Vutec or somewhere if you have not already done so and see if that is an issue for you.


The Silverstar is not the best screen for rooms with ambient light.

I should add the issue with the appearance of the screen surface gets better as you move further back. From 11 feet from a 110" Silverstar, it bothered me, but a few feet back from that, it was much less of an issue.


If you want a high gain screen, the better choice may be the Da-lite High Power. You would want to lower the projector so that you would get the most value from the retroflective nature of the screen. The brighter the image, the better, when it comes to fighting ambient light. Ambient light is going to compromise the image more than anything.
